RE: Ever see a fox eat corn? Leaf River Pics
Yeah cool pics.......Gray Fox are omnivorous like a bear, and eat quite a bit of plant food (moreso than a Red Fox) they feed heavily on cottontail rabbits, mice, voles, other small mammals, birds, insects, and much plant material, including corn, apples, persimmons, nuts, cherries, grapes, pokeweed fruit, grass, and blackberries.
